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
716 416484588 49841566 646 98458925032
59724 0596434
59724 0596434
48971825 33428 65610440091
All about undefined
Interested in learning more?
59724 0596434
48971825 33428 65610440091
See more
2256241 6525732 25765113790
87218568 14942864886 637323315
See more
03678370 6207 14985507
0148931 991968 7225430307
See more